## Who to ping about GiftNote

Welcome aboard! GiftNote is our donation-receipt mailer for the Larchfield Fund. Template tweaks go to the comms folks; delivery failures and bounce weirdness go to the platform crew. Don't push template changes on Fridays — receipts batch over the weekend. For anything GiftNote-related, start with the address below.

billing contact of kaweg-tajeg = drudor.lamion.oliath@torvalabs.test

TICKET #4417 — Priority: High

The Quellish telemetry ingest job is failing auth since 02:10. Credentials for the compressor service expired last night and nobody rotated them.

Payload compression (zstd level 6) is still running locally, so buffers are filling on the edge nodes — about 4 hours of headroom before drops start.

Fix: swap the expired credential in the ingest config and restart the compressor workers. A fresh key has been issued for the compression service.

API key for fadug-fafof: kto7_7rjklQM

## Recovering the Publish Account — Lintbarrel Component Library

Hey, welcome aboard! If you ever get locked out of the shared publish account for Lintbarrel (our versioned component library), don't panic — it happens every quarter when tokens rotate. First, bump nothing; version tags stay frozen during recovery. Then open the recovery console from the Driftwell admin panel and enter the passphrase shown below.

vault phrase of bagaf-kajeg = jorath-feniel-briir-siliel-ralix

## Changelog — ScanBridge 2.9

We renamed the setting `SCANNER_KEY` to `SCANBRIDGE_API_SECRET` to match our naming convention for the Lintwood barcode gateway. The legacy name no longer works, and the integration will reject handshake attempts without the new one. When setting up your local environment, open the `.env` file in the repo root and add this line:

sealed setting: ARCHIVE_KEY3=8d0